Topics Covered
- Advanced Process Dynamics: This module covers the dynamic behavior of chemical processes and control systems.
- Advanced Control Strategies: This module teaches advanced control algorithms and strategies for chemical processes.
- Model Predictive Control: This module focuses on the implementation and tuning of model predictive control systems.
- Nonlinear Control Systems: This module explores the design and analysis of control systems for nonlinear processes.
- Process Identification and Estimation: This module discusses techniques for identifying and estimating process models for control.
- Control System Design and Implementation: This module covers the practical aspects of designing and implementing control systems in chemical engineering.
